This market will resolve to the temperature range that contains the highest temperature recorded by NOAA at the Wellington Intl Airport Station in degrees Celsius on 1 Sep '26. The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=nzwn If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source. In the event which there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ket. To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C. This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source. The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market. Current model consensus shows scattered showers clearing overnight, followed by light southerlies turning northerly, limiting daytime heating. Hourly guidance from multiple sources (Yr, WeatherBug, Met Office) peaks in the 12–13°C range, while the authoritative MetService outlook explicitly lists 14°C as the high. This narrow band reflects typical September variability around the long-term average high of ~13–15°C, with no strong warm advection or blocking highs to push temperatures higher. The low probabilities assigned to 15°C or above (and sub-13°C outcomes) indicate traders view significant deviations as unlikely given the stable synoptic pattern and short time remaining before resolution.
